#6660c6 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6660c6 is composed of 40% red, 37.6% green and 77.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.5% cyan, 51.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 243.5 degrees, a saturation of 47.2% and a lightness of 57.6%. #6660c6 color hex could be obtained by blending #ccc0ff with #00008d.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

#6660c6 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6660c6 has RGB values of R:102, G:96, B:198 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0.52, Y:0,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 6709446.
